Position Overview

We are currently seeking Clinical Interns pursuing a Master’s degree in Counseling, Social Work, Psychology, or Marriage and Family Therapy. This part-time internship requires a minimum of 16 hours per week, including two evening shifts (required). The Clinical Intern will provide therapeutic services to their preferred population (children, adolescents, and/or adults) under the supervision of our experienced clinical leadership team.

This role offers a hands-on learning experience in a supportive and collaborative environment, helping interns gain essential skills in diagnosis, treatment planning, and therapeutic interventions. This is a paid internship at a rate of $20.00 per hour.


Key Responsibilities

  • Provide individual, group, and family counseling to clients experiencing mental health and/or substance use challenges.
  • Build rapport and establish a trusting therapeutic relationship with clients.
  • Conduct mental health assessments, develop treatment plans, and implement evidence-based interventions.
  • Diagnose and treat anxiety, depression, PTSD, trauma, and other mental health conditions under supervision.
  • Collaborate with the Clinical Director, CEO, and other therapists to ensure coordinated care.
  • Refer clients to specialists or community resources when necessary.
  • Maintain timely and accurate clinical documentation in the Electronic Health Record (EHR) system.
  • Participate in weekly supervision meetings and monthly clinical team meetings for case consultation and professional development.
  • Provide trainings and workshops as needed.
  • Uphold ethical and legal standards in counseling, ensuring culturally competent and trauma-informed care.
